9b05e5c67e Fix: delimiter is chunk boundary, drop token_size atom-split (OVER_CAP default) (#17808)
## Summary

Fixes a regression introduced by #17203 (strict-cap atom-split) and a
secondary delimiter-handling bug from #17723.

**Root cause:**
- #17203 added `_split_oversized_unit` / `_compute_chunk_update`, which
split oversize units into ≤ token_size pieces. This collapsed
`token_size=1` into 1-token chunks and set the cap at 512, mismatching
the model-layer truncation boundary (embedding ~8191 / rerank
500/4096/8192/2048). Atom-split is unnecessary: oversize units stay
whole and the model layer truncates.
- #17723's delimiter handling dropped consecutive delimiters (`A####B`
-> `A##B`), glued JSON items with `"".join`, ignored
`children_delimiters`, and stripped whitespace delimiters.

## Changes

- New pure helper `merge_paragraphs(paragraphs, token_size, strategy)`
with a `MergeStrategy` enum (`UNDER_CAP` / `OVER_CAP`); **default
`OVER_CAP`**. `UNDER_CAP` is a strict cap (never overflows
`token_size`); `OVER_CAP` greedily accumulates adjacent paragraphs while
the projected total stays within `token_size`, merging one
boundary-overflow paragraph before closing. Oversize paragraphs stand
alone.
- `naive_merge` / `naive_merge_with_images` /
`RAGFlowTxtParser.parser_txt` now use `merge_paragraphs`; atom-split
removed. `naive_merge` / `naive_merge_with_images` always split a
section on the delimiter whenever one is present (even when the section
already fits `token_size`), so delimiter text never leaks into a chunk.
Only the empty-delimiter (size-only) mode skips splitting.
- `token_chunker`: delimiter text is dropped (not stripped); JSON flush
joins buffered items with `"\n"`; `children_delimiters` and
`PDF_POSITIONS_KEY` are preserved on the delimiter path. PDF positions
are now attributed **per segment** — each split chunk carries only the
positions of the item(s) that contributed to it — fixing a leak where
page-N coordinates were attached to page-M chunks and all segments
shared one preview image.
- `test_txt_parser.py` rewritten to assert the new contract (not the old
strict cap); `naive_merge` and delimiter-case-sensitive matrices
updated.

## Contract (refs #17799)

- user specified delimiter = chunk boundary; user specified delimiter
text never enters a chunk.
- `token_size` = soft target + merge strategy; no atom-split.
- Default strategy = `OVER_CAP`; migration can switch to `UNDER_CAP`
(strict cap).
- `OVER_CAP` has no hard cap; the model layer truncates oversize units.
`UNDER_CAP` enforces a strict cap.

## Notes

- Closes the wrong-object revert in #17774 (revert #17723 would
re-introduce delimiter-in-chunk and the strict cap).
- Go-side alignment (`internal/ingestion/component/chunker/token.go`) is
a follow-up PR.

deb3d0c201 fix(chunker): enforce strict chunk_token_num cap on .txt / PDF / email paths (#17203)
Fixes #17202 (and complements #12109).

## Problem

`RAGFlowTxtParser.parser_txt` (`deepdoc/parser/txt_parser.py:36-47`) and
`rag.nlp.naive_merge` (`rag/nlp/__init__.py:1171-1193`) fire their size
check *after* the append, so every chunk can overshoot `chunk_token_num`
by up to the size of one unit. With overlap enabled, the prefix is
prepended and `tnum` is recounted, but the projection is never
re-checked — overlapping chunks silently exceed the budget by
`overlap_tokens`.

A third, atomic case: a single line / sentence that exceeds the budget
with no internal delimiter is added whole because the regex split
returns it as one un-splittable unit and there is no atom-level
fallback. `RAGFlowHtmlParser.chunk_block` already implements exactly
this hard-cap pattern, but the text / email paths reuse the broken
chunker and do not.

Measured on a live dataset (336 `.txt` files, 154,103 chunks, config
`chunk_token_num=512 delimiter=\n overlapped_percent=0.1`): 56.5% of
stored chunks exceed 512 tokens; the worst outlier is 14,813 tokens /
60,293 chars in a single chunk. Symptom downstream: rerank failures on
the >2048-token outliers (ref. #12109) and silent embedding truncation
on every oversize chunk.

## Fix

Mirror the proven pattern in `RAGFlowHtmlParser.chunk_block`:

1. **Proactive projected-total check** in `TxtParser.parser_txt` and in
`naive_merge.add_chunk`:
   ```python
   if cks[-1] == "":
       cks[-1] = t; tk_nums[-1] = tnum; return
   if tk_nums[-1] + tnum <= chunk_token_num:
       cks[-1] += "\n" + t; tk_nums[-1] += tnum; return
   cks.append(t); tk_nums.append(tnum)
   ```
The check uses the *projected* total and runs *before* the append, so
the cap is exact, never approached-then-exceeded.

2. **Overlap-aware projection in `naive_merge`**: when overlap is
enabled, the prefix is prepended only when `overlap_tokens + tnum <=
chunk_token_num`; otherwise the overlap is dropped at that boundary. The
naive_merge-with-images mirror gets the same treatment. Custom-delimiter
behaviour is preserved per the existing test suite.

3. **Atom sub-splitter** for units that still exceed the budget after
the regex split. Whitespace atoms with a character-window fallback for
scripts without word boundaries — same shape as the existing
`html_parser._split_oversized_block`, so behaviour matches for HTML vs
`.txt` vs PDF atomic-oversize.

A small shared helper (`_compute_overlap_prefix`) lives next to
`naive_merge` in `rag/nlp/__init__.py` so the three call sites
(`naive_merge`, `_with_images`, and the explicit `pos` branch) agree on
the carve index.

## Result on the dataset above

| | Before | After |
|---|---|---|
| Chunks > 512 tokens | 56.5% | 0% |
| Median tokens | 539 | <= 512 |
| Largest chunk | 14,813 tokens | <= 512 tokens |

## Tests

- Tightened the existing tolerances (`+10` and `+2` slack) to `0` — they
existed only to document the soft-cap bug.
- Added `test_strict_cap_no_overlap_packs_to_budget`,
`test_strict_cap_with_overlap_drops_overlap_at_overflow_boundary`,
`test_strict_cap_overlap_chosen_when_it_fits`,
`test_strict_cap_single_overlong_section_is_sub_split_on_whitespace` for
`naive_merge`.
- Added `test_images_strict_cap_packs_to_budget` for
`naive_merge_with_images`.
- New `test/unit_test/deepdoc/parser/test_txt_parser.py` covers
`parser_txt` strict cap and atom sub-split. Uses the same path-loading
pattern as the existing `test_html_parser.py` to avoid pulling the deep
import chain into a test-time-only venv.

## Out of scope

- `MarkdownParser`, `naive_merge_docx`, and the docx / epub / json paths
use a different `_merge_cks` machinery (`rag/nlp/__init__.py:1574`) that
already enforces the budget. They are unchanged.
- The `chunk_block` call sites in `deepdoc/parser/html_parser.py` are
unchanged; they already enforce the cap and serve as the reference
implementation this PR mirrors.

Validation against the full 336-file dataset is left for review so the
PR can land without re-ingestion.
